correct, you get an ITEM that you can *use* and then you get a little icon that counts down the 1hr or 8hr buff.

but honestly, don't waste money on that stuff.

it's only a 20% boost (that is XP reward x 1.20 )

that means if you take a 1 hour buff you get XP like you played 1 hour and 12 minutes

an 8 hr buff gives you a bonus as if you played 96 minutes longer

but that is if you are constantly earning XP in that time without slowing down.
fly back only once to ESD and clean your inventory for 15 minutes and your Bonus is wasted.
Replay the Azura mission (Stranded in Space) once and get the Azura Personal Com Code. This will allow you to call on the Azura once per hour (in Space time, the count stops when you enter a Ground map). The Azura can relay your Mail, access your Personal Bank and sells Commodities. And since she has a store you can also sell any extra drops you don't want.

And the XP bonuses are most handy in areas where you don't have to fly around a lot. Exploration zones (Delta Volanis, Arucanis Arm, etc.) are ideal for leveling while using an XP bonus. You don't have to travel as far to get to the next mission. Sometimes you don't have to travel at all. Be sure to get the corresponding Exploration mission for the area you are working every three missions to maximize your XP gain.